Reliance will produce defence equipment In MP

The production of defence equipment by Reliance Defence Technologies Pvt Ltd, which is in the process of setting up one of India’s largest defence parks at Special Economic Zone (SEZ), Pithampur, Madhya Pradesh, is likely to begin soon after the company submitted the licences approved by the Union government to the Madhya Pradesh government last week. The Pithampur SEZ is situated about 30 km from Indore in Dhar district.
Official sources in the state commerce and industry department said that with the submission of the licences, all the formalities needed by the state government for the commencement of production of defence equipment have been completed.
“Last week, they (Reliance Defence Technologies Pvt Ltd) submitted the approval and licences given to them by the Union government to us. Now a team of officials from the Madhya Pradesh Audyogik Kendra Vikas Nigam (AKVN, a state body that oversees development in the SEZ), will be going to Pithampur to prepare a report on the ‘preparedness’ of the plot that has been allotted to Reliance Defence Technologies Pvt Ltd, and the report will be shared with the Union government and Reliance Defence Technologies Pvt Ltd so that they can start work as soon as possible,” a Bhopal-based official with the state industry department said.
The Department of Industrial Policy & Promotion, Union Ministry of Commerce, had in March given approval for 12 industrial licences to Reliance Defence Ltd, a subsidiary of Anil Ambani-led Reliance Infrastructure Ltd, allowing it to manufacture systems to address the defence requirements in India and overseas markets and forge tie-ups with international original equipment manufacturers (OEMs).
The official said that around 300 acres of land have been allotted to Reliance Defence Technologies Pvt Ltd and fencing of the land has already been done. “Now the only thing that remains is the handing over of the possession of the plot to Reliance Defence Technologies Pvt Ltd,” the official said. The initial investment that the Anil Ambani-led Reliance Defence Technologies Pvt Ltd is expected to make in its defence park is likely to be around Rs 3,000 crore, the official said. It is likely to be the biggest single investment under the “Make in India” campaign till now.
People familiar with the development said that in the initial stage, Reliance Defence Technologies Pvt Ltd will be focusing on developing helicopters, un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s), all-terrain combat vehicles (ATCVs), night-vision devices, electronic counter measures (ECM), besides heavy weapons (artillery guns, mortars, rocket launchers) at the Pithampur defence park.
Industry department officials also said that Reliance Defence Technologies Pvt Ltd was looking at extra land because of the the joint venture (JV) that it had formed with Rafael Advanced Defence Systems of Israel. “We are already in the process of identifying around 80-100 acres of additional land in Pithampur for Reliance Defence Technologies Pvt Ltd so that it can be handed over to them,” the official quoted above said.
